Pictures aren't a problem necessarily; it's the wording of a post that goes with the pictures that is typically the problem. If a post is determined to be an ad, whether blatant or subtle, it will be deleted. There is to be no advertising in any folder on this forum except for the Advertise Your Business folder or Shop with WAHMs (for hand made products) and that includes the general company folders and the company-specific folders. To advertise is not why those folders were set up.

Now if someone wants to talk about their vacation in a non-advertorial way, fine, they can post pics. A lot of members share pictures here. However, if they post pics and say "Look how much I earned this month from X company and I took this great vacation because it's such an awesome company and I earn so much and here are the pics," it should be deleted.
